Measuring True Impact with View-Through Attribution

Attribution is notoriously difficult in digital marketing. Factors.ai tackles this head-on by promising to “Measure LinkedIn’s true impact and 2x your ROI with view-through attribution.” This is a powerful claim. View-through attribution VTA tracks conversions that occur after a user sees an ad but doesn’t necessarily click on it.

  • Significance: Many B2B journeys involve multiple touchpoints. VTA helps capture the influence of impressions, not just clicks, on the overall conversion path.
  • Challenge it addresses: Traditional last-click attribution often undervalues the role of upper-funnel awareness campaigns like LinkedIn ads. Factors.ai suggests it can accurately credit these campaigns.

Optimizing Performance with CAPI and Intent-Based Campaigns

The platform emphasizes running “intent-based campaigns and optimize ad performance with CAPI.” CAPI refers to the Conversions API, which allows direct server-to-server communication of conversion events, bypassing browser limitations and improving data accuracy for ad platforms.

  • Benefit of CAPI: Enhanced accuracy in tracking conversions, leading to better ad optimization by LinkedIn’s algorithms. This is especially important with increasing privacy regulations like cookie deprecation.
  • Intent-based campaigns: By integrating its intent data with LinkedIn Ads, Factors.ai enables advertisers to target accounts that are actively showing buying signals, rather than just relying on demographics or job titles.
  • Result: Highly relevant ad delivery, leading to lower cost-per-click CPC and higher conversion rates. Targeting based on intent can increase conversion rates by 50% or more.

SOC2 Type II and GDPR Compliance

  • SOC2 Type II: This attestation report, issued by independent auditors, confirms that a service organization like Factors.ai maintains robust controls over data security, availability, processing integrity, confidentiality, and privacy over a specific period. It’s a gold standard for SaaS companies.
  • GDPR General Data Protection Regulation: This is a comprehensive data privacy law in the European Union that sets strict rules on how personal data is collected, processed, and stored. Compliance indicates that Factors.ai is built to handle data in a privacy-conscious manner, which is important for any global business.
